Brush burning causes heavy smoke near Texaco RoadFort Lawn SC

audio iconFire & Arson
SC-9 & Texaco Rd, Fort Lawn, SC 29714

Multiple calls reported thick black smoke near Texaco Road and Highway 9. Fire units investigated and found that someone was burning brush, causing the heavy smoke in the area.
